/*#################### NEW PHOTWALL STYLES ####################*/
#photowallContentContainer * {margin:0px; padding:0px;}
#photowallContentContainer .footer {clear:both;}
#photowallContentContainer {width:626px; font-family:Arial, Helvetica, sans-serif; font-size:10px;}
#photowallContentContainer .topPhotowallSubTitleBar h4 {color:#C00; font-size:1.5em; padding-bottom:3px;}
#photowallContentContainer #photoNav {background:#000; font-size:1.1em; font-weight:bold; text-transform:uppercase;}
#photowallContentContainer #photoNav a {text-decoration:none}
#photowallContentContainer #photoNav p {padding-top:8px;}

#photowallContentContainer #photoNav #photoNavNext {float:right; width:200px; text-align:left;height:35px;}
#photowallContentContainer #photoNav #photoNavNext img {border:none; margin:5px 30px 3px 6px; float:right;}
#photowallContentContainer #photoNav #photoNavNext p {color: #fff; float:right;}

#photowallContentContainer #photoNav #photoNavPrevious {float:left; width:200px; text-align:left;height:35px;}
#photowallContentContainer #photoNav #photoNavPrevious p {color: #fff; float:left;}
#photowallContentContainer #photoNav #photoNavPrevious img {border:none; margin:5px 6px 3px 30px; float:left;}

#photowallContentContainer #photoNav .scrollerBottom {background:url(/images/i-pw-scroller-bottom.gif) no-repeat; height:2px; overflow:hidden; clear:both;}

#photowallContentContainer #photoThumbs {background:#C00; margin-top:10px;}
#photowallContentContainer #photoThumbs .scrollerTop {background:url(/images/i-pw-scroller-top.gif) no-repeat; height:2px; overflow:hidden;}
#photowallContentContainer #photoThumbs .scrollerBottom {background:url(/images/i-pw-scroller-bottom.gif) no-repeat; height:2px; overflow:hidden; clear:both;}
#photowallContentContainer #photoThumbsPrevious, #photowallContentContainer #photoThumbsNext {float:left; width:31px; text-align:center;}
#photowallContentContainer #photoThumbs img {border:none;}
#photowallContentContainer #photoThumbsPrevious img, #photowallContentContainer #photoThumbsNext img {margin-top:18px;}
#photowallContentContainer #photoThumbPics {float:left; width:500px;}
#photowallContentContainer #photoThumbPics ul {list-style-type:none;}
#photowallContentContainer #photoThumbPics ul li {display:inline; width: auto; white-space: nowrap; z-index: 100;}
#photowallContentContainer #photoThumbPics img {border:1px solid #000; width:59px; height:59px; margin:0px;}
#photowallContentContainer #photoDisplay {background:#222; padding:5px;}
#photowallContentContainer #photowallContainer .paddingContainer {padding:0px 30px; color:#CECECE;}

#photowallContentContainer #searchGalleryContainer {border-top:1px solid #808080; border-bottom:1px solid #808080; margin-bottom:10px;}
#photowallContentContainer #searchGalleryContainer .areaPadding {padding:5px 0px; font-size:1.1em; font-weight:bold; z-index: 999;}
#photowallContentContainer #searchGalleryContainer .topPhotowallSearchBar {float:left; z-index: 999;width:500px;}
#photowallContentContainer #searchGalleryContainer .gallerySearchLink {float:right; text-align:right; color: #fff;}
#photowallContentContainer #searchGalleryContainer label {float:left; padding:4px 5px 0px 0px; color: #fff;width:100px;}
#photowallContentContainer #searchGalleryContainer select {float:left;font-size:1.1em; zoom: 1;margin:3px 0px 0px 5px;}
#photowallContentContainer #searchGalleryContainer .photoSearchBtn {float:left;padding:10px 0px 0px 5px;}

#photowallContainer #photoDisplay #photo {float:left; text-align:center;margin:auto; text-align:center;width: 100%;overflow:hidden;}
#photowallContainer #photoDisplay #photo img { }
#photowallContainer #photoDisplay #photoCaption {float:left; width: 100%;margin-bottom:20px;}
#photowallContainer #photoDisplay h4 {color:#C00; font-size:1.2em; font-weight:bold; padding:5px 0px;}
#photowallContainer #photoDisplay p {font-size:1.1em; color: #fff;}
#photowallContainer #photoDisplay a {color:#C00;}




/*#################### NEW PHOTWALL HC STYLES ####################*/
#photowallContentContainerHC * {margin:0px; padding:0px;}
#photowallContentContainerHC .footer {clear:both;}
#photowallContentContainerHC {float:left;width:550px; font-family:Arial, Helvetica, sans-serif; font-size:10px;}
#photowallContentContainerHC .topPhotowallSubTitleBar h4 {color:#C00; font-size:1.5em; padding-bottom:3px;}
#photowallContentContainerHC #photoNav {background:#000; font-size:1.1em; font-weight:bold; text-transform:uppercase;}
#photowallContentContainerHC #photoNav a {text-decoration:none}
#photowallContentContainerHC #photoNav p {padding-top:8px;}

#photowallContentContainerHC #photoNav #photoNavNext {float:right; width:200px; text-align:left;height:35px;}
#photowallContentContainerHC #photoNav #photoNavNext img {border:none; margin:5px 30px 3px 6px; float:right;}
#photowallContentContainerHC #photoNav #photoNavNext p {color: #fff; float:right;}

#photowallContentContainerHC #photoNav #photoNavPrevious {float:left; width:200px; text-align:left;height:35px;}
#photowallContentContainerHC #photoNav #photoNavPrevious p {color: #fff; float:left;}
#photowallContentContainerHC #photoNav #photoNavPrevious img {border:none; margin:5px 6px 3px 30px; float:left;}

#photowallContentContainerHC #photoNav .scrollerBottom {background:url(/images/i-pw-scroller-bottom.gif) no-repeat; height:2px; overflow:hidden; clear:both;}

#photowallContentContainerHC #photoThumbs {background:#C00; margin-top:10px;}
#photowallContentContainerHC #photoThumbs .scrollerTop {background:url(/images/i-pw-scroller-top.gif) no-repeat; height:2px; overflow:hidden;}
#photowallContentContainerHC #photoThumbs .scrollerBottom {background:url(/images/i-pw-scroller-bottom.gif) no-repeat; height:2px; overflow:hidden; clear:both;}
#photowallContentContainerHC #photoThumbsPrevious, #photowallContentContainerHC #photoThumbsNext {float:left; width:25px; text-align:center;}
#photowallContentContainerHC #photoThumbs img {border:none;}
#photowallContentContainerHC #photoThumbsPrevious img, #photowallContentContainerHC #photoThumbsNext img {margin-top:18px;}
#photowallContentContainerHC #photoThumbPics {float:left; width:480px;}
#photowallContentContainerHC #photoThumbPics ul {list-style-type:none;}
#photowallContentContainerHC #photoThumbPics ul li {display:inline; width: auto; white-space: nowrap; z-index: 100;}
#photowallContentContainerHC #photoThumbPics img {border:1px solid #000; width:54px; height:54px; margin:0px;}
#photowallContentContainerHC #photoDisplay {background:#222; padding:5px;}
#photowallContentContainerHC #photowallContainer .paddingContainer {padding:0px 10px; color:#CECECE;}

#photowallContentContainerHC #searchGalleryContainer {border-top:1px solid #808080; border-bottom:1px solid #808080; margin-bottom:10px;}
#photowallContentContainerHC #searchGalleryContainer .areaPadding {padding:5px 0px; font-size:1.1em; font-weight:bold; z-index: 999;}
#photowallContentContainerHC #searchGalleryContainer .topPhotowallSearchBar {float:left; z-index: 999;width:400px;overflow:hidden;}
#photowallContentContainerHC #searchGalleryContainer .gallerySearchLink {float:right; text-align:right; color: #fff;}
#photowallContentContainerHC #searchGalleryContainer label {float:left; padding:4px 5px 0px 0px; color: #fff;width:100px;}
#photowallContentContainerHC #searchGalleryContainer select {float:left;font-size:1.1em; zoom: 1;margin:3px 0px 0px 5px;}
#photowallContentContainerHC #searchGalleryContainer .photoSearchBtn {float:left;padding:10px 0px 0px 5px;}

#photowallContainerHC #photoDisplay #photo {float:left; text-align:center;margin:auto; text-align:center;width: 100%;overflow:hidden;}
#photowallContainerHC #photoDisplay #photo img { }
#photowallContainerHC #photoDisplay #photoCaption {float:left; width: 100%;margin-bottom:20px;}
#photowallContainerHC #photoDisplay h4 {color:#C00; font-size:1.2em; font-weight:bold; padding:5px 0px;}
#photowallContainerHC #photoDisplay p {font-size:1.1em; color: #fff;}
#photowallContainerHC #photoDisplay a {color:#C00;}

#hotchickRightcolum {float:left;width:160px;padding-top:30px;margin-left:10px;font-family:Arial, Helvetica, sans-serif; font-size:11px;color:#fff;}
#hotchickRightcolum a {color:#fff;}
